Output 58cc631f5dc492b4edc0bb5c9aeb392e24fd1ae096dffdc91b56a3730ee552a3:63

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 739f561b27f34f6caa733975ac86dd35b6c721dcd2b490d737b8078f0b21422c
address
tb1pww04vxe87d8ke2nn8966epkaxkmvwgwu626fp4ehhqrc7zepggkqcqv5ca
transaction
58cc631f5dc492b4edc0bb5c9aeb392e24fd1ae096dffdc91b56a3730ee552a3